KRS-One (Nov 15)
I had another chance to see my favorite MC on stage at the Shrine. He didn't disappoint. He was the typical KRS - tight lyrics, command of the stage, engaged the crowd, showed respect for the MC's that deserve it, and so on... His 15 minute lecture at the end of the show was well done. The new MC's could learn a thing or two.
In addition to performing many classics, he performed some new tracks. I'm looking forward to hearing how they are received by his fans. The lyrics were great. The beats were a bit more plodding than usual, but at a live show, you can't really tell.
